Songa Offshore: Latest Fleet Update
Songa Offshore is an International Midwater Drilling Contractor with a strong presence in the harsh environment North Atlantic basin. It operated a fleet of 5 rigs in June 2014 as follows:
Songa Dee achieved an operational efficiency of 100% and an earnings efficiency of 100% during the month working for Statoil in Norway.
Songa Delta achieved an operational efficiency of 100% and an earnings efficiency of 100% during the month working for Statoil in Norway.
Songa Trym achieved an operational efficiency of 100% and an earnings efficiency of 97% during the month working for Statoil in Norway.
Songa Venus went off contract on 6 May 2014, and is now stacked in Labuan, Malaysia, where it pursues future work.
Songa Mercur achieved an operational efficiency of 89% and an earnings efficiency of 88% during the month working for Idemitsu in Vietnam. The unit experienced downtime mid-June due to unplanned BOP maintenance.
